Coty Inc. is engaged in manufacturing, marketing and distribution of women's and men's fragrances, color cosmetics and skin and body care related products globally. The Company operates in three segments: Fragrances, Color Cosmetics and Skin & Body Care. The Company's power brands consist of adidas, Calvin Klein, Chloe, Davidoff, Marc Jacobs, OPI, philosophy, Playboy, Rimmel and Sally Hansen. The Company sells products in each of its segments through retailers, including hypermarkets, supermarkets, independent and chain drug stores and pharmacies, upscale perfumeries, upscale and mid-tier department stores, nail salons, specialty retailers, duty-free shops and traditional food, drug and mass retailers. The staff at Coty come from unusually diverse demographic backgrounds. The company is 58.1% female and 42.8% ethnic minorities. Coty employees are slightly more likely to be members of the Democratic Party than the Republican Party, with 61.0% of employees identifying as members of the Democratic Party. Despite their political differences, employees at Coty seem to be happy. The company has great employee retention with staff members usually staying for 4.8 years.The average employee at Coty makes $54,824 per year, which is competitive for its industry and location. Some of its highest paying competitors, Noxell, Clairol, and OPI, pay $59,966, $54,537, and $53,622, respectively.
Based in New York, NY, Coty is an industry leader with 20,000 employees and an annual revenue of $6.1B.
